Transaction 75c03010fa570dcf166b60b85e8d9b88d9ee677100381fa0bb4e9dfde60a561d

block
189293570fb7a4aa567db0b29be9b9b76e670204cdc3149d3dd98c4b6098da18

1 Input

2 Outputs